| Obverse description | The coat of arms of the Federation of Arab Republics occupies the central field, depicting the Hawk of Quraish displayed with wings spread, bearing a shield on its breast and clutching a scroll at its base inscribed with the federation's name in Arabic. The eagle's detailing is rendered in low relief with finely striated feathering. A circular Arabic legend in Kufic script runs along the lower periphery of the field, identifying both the Federation of Arab Republics and the Arab Republic of Egypt. |
